## Break-Glass: Cron Drift Investigation

During the Pellwright cron drift inquiry, the scheduler host was fenced and normal SSH access revoked. Release managers needing forensic access must file an incident note, obtain sign-off from the duty officer, and use the sealed console. Every session is recorded and reviewed. Entry to the sealed console is gated by the recovery passphrase below.

unlock words, hahip-baduf: holwyn-istath-julvan

## Break-Glass Access — User Module Split (Project Severin)

Welcome aboard. While we extract the user module from the Caldra monolith, break-glass access to the interim user database is restricted to incidents only. Log every use in the migration journal. The break-glass console will ask for the recovery passphrase, noted just below.

unlock words, yawig-kagef: gordor-holvan-ulaael-pramir-ulaiel-tamdor

Handover — Snapframe thumbnail queue

Ownership moves from me (Orin) to Petya. Quick facts for new folks: the queue consumes upload events, renders three sizes, writes to the media store. Known issues: oversized TIFFs can wedge a worker; there's a kill-switch flag for that. Retries are capped at five, then dead-lettered. Scaling is manual — bump worker count during campaign launches. Don't touch the resize codec pin without checking with the media team first. Runbook, dashboards, and dead-letter drain steps are all on the internal page here.

runbook for badug-kadup: https://confluence.zemvarlabs.internal/projects/browse/display/projects/bd1b